The Georgia General Assembly recently launched its new public website.

 

The new Website went live on Sunday, Dec. 20, 2020 and is part of the state legislature’s multi-year software project to modernize its Legislative Management System.

 

House Speaker David Ralston said the new public website is the first phase of updating this legislative technology package.

 

The web site, at www.legis.ga.gov, now has a mobile-first responsive design for phones and tablets and contains a new streamlined menu structure for easy navigation. 

 

It also provides quick access to House and Senate meeting schedules, committee meetings and important legislative documents, such as Rules Committee bill calendars and daily voting composites. 

 

Additionally, the site includes updated search functions to find legislation and individual legislators, and a new “Chamber News and Events” section to increase awareness of House and Senate events at the Capitol and across the state.
